Output e3cefa7320dea26e25fe86d79d32c84a33ef787ea162e3ff2bf1135dc32a9c71:0

value
3685980
script pubkey
OP_0 OP_PUSHBYTES_20 861cc3bf761752791328a2349fff78f8091a34e1
address
bc1qscwv80mkzaf8jyeg5g6fllmclqy35d8pvxy4u4
transaction
e3cefa7320dea26e25fe86d79d32c84a33ef787ea162e3ff2bf1135dc32a9c71
spent
true